Vincent Anthony “Vince” Vaughn is an American actor, producer, screenwriter, activist, and comedian.

Early life

Vincent Anthony “Vince” Vaughn – born on March 28, 1970, in the Minneapolis, Minnesota. He is the son of real estate agent Sharon Eileen and toy salesman, Vernon Lindsay Vaughn.

Their ancestry comes from Scots-Irish ethnic group, known as The Ulster Scots. Throughout his grandparents, he has an Italian and Lebanese origin.

Vincent has two older sisters and grew up in Chicago. He attended the Lake Forest High School and soon as he graduated, he moved to Los Angeles.

Acting career

After being a part of television commercial Chevrolet cast in 1988, Vincent gains the first role in the dramatic television series China Beach (1989).

Vince also appeared in three seasons of anthology series for teenagers CBS Schoolbreak Special ( 1990 ).

The first movie role he gains in biographical sports film Rudy, where he played Jamie O’Hare. After failed initial testing of revival private detective series 77 Sunset Strip, where Vance was the lead role, he didn’t have any significant roles until 1996. That year he filmed comedy-drama movie Swingers, where his co-partner was Jon Favreau – his real life friend. With only $200,000budget, the film earned  $4,555,020 and became an independent film.

After this success, Vince gain role in box office hit The Lost World: Jurassic Park, directed by Steven Spielberg. He portrayed well-traveled documentarian, Nick Van Owen.

In 1998 he played in drama-thriller film Return to Paradise as John “Sheriff” Volgecherev, with Ana Heche and Joaquin Phoenix. In the same year, he filmed crime-comedy film Clay Pigeons, where he portrayed a serial killer Lester Long.

He starred in the sci-fi psychological thriller The Cell as Special Agent Peter Novak. Next year he took a role in crime comedy film Made as Ricky Slade. He also appeared in the western movie South of Heaven, West of Hell as Taylor Henry.

A major increase in his popularity brought the role in the sophomoric comedy Old School ( 2003 ), where he played Bernard “Beanie” Campbell. This movie was box office hit. Next year he appeared in crime-action buddy cop comedy Starsky & Hutch and sports comedy DodgeBall: A True Underdog Story, both with Ben Stiller.

Another box office achievement, he scores with the role in romantic comedy Wedding Crashers, where his partner was Owen Wilson. This movie earned $200 million.

In 2006, he played with then-girlfriend Jennifer Aniston in the romantic comedy The Break-Up. Vince tried himself as holiday humorist when he took the role of a sarcastic older brother of Santa Claus in the film Fred Claus and Four Christmases.

In 2009 he played with Malin Akerman in the movie Couple’s Retreat and two years later he starred in another comedy The Dilemma.

Producer career

Vince co-produced a lot of films where he played such as Fred Claus, The Break-Up, Couples Retreat, The Dilemma. He produced a comedy documentary film Wild West Comedy Show: 30 Days and 30 Nights – Hollywood to the Heartland and Netflix documentary Art of Conflict.

In 2013 he wrote and produce comedy film The Internship, where he played the lead role with Owen Wilson. Three years later, Vince produces crime thriller Term Life, where he portrayed a thief Nick Barrow.
